Rdlc隐藏列

时间:2013-11-25 07:51:06

标签: reportviewer rdlc

我有一份rdlc报告,如下所示。如果AraciFirma从Dataset1为空,我想设置可见的假AraciFirmaField。可能吗 ?我能怎么做 ?

<DataSet Name="DataSet1">
      <Fields>
        <Field Name="AraciFirma">
          <DataField>AraciFirma</DataField>
          <rd:TypeName>System.String</rd:TypeName>
        </Field>
        <Field Name="AliciFirma">
          <DataField>AliciFirma</DataField>
          <rd:TypeName>System.String</rd:TypeName>
        </Field>
..........

2 个答案:

答案 0 :(得分:0)

在AraciFirmaField的Visibility.Hidden属性中,您必须指定对象是否必须隐藏。所以你可以使用:

=IIf(IsNothing(Fields!AraciFirma.Value), True, False)

答案 1 :(得分:0)

  • 在tablix中选择列
  • 转到列可见性选项
  • 根据表达式选择显示或隐藏列。